DC to reissue the comic that current Batman writer Matt Fraction says shows that the Dark Knight is "capable of wonder and joy"

Batman: Universe by Brian Michael Bendis and Nick Derrington is getting a new hardcover release in 2026, complete with an introduction from new Batwriter Matt Fraction

Good news for fans of a Batman who knows how to smile — February 2026 sees the release of a new edition of Batman Universe, the miniseries by Brian Michael Bendis and Nick Derrington in which the Caped Crusader travels the DC Universe in search of an object of unexpected power… running into everyone from the Joker and Green Lantern to Jonah Hex and immortal caveman Vandal Savage in the process. It’s a fun story that celebrates how ridiculous the DCU can be — and because of that very reason, it’s a favorite of new Batman writer Matt Fraction.

Fraction actually provides the introduction to the new edition of Batman Universe, officially entitled Batman: Universe Deluxe Edition, due out February 2026. At Rose City Comic Con 2025, he explained why he got involved with the reissue of the book.

“Part of the reason I wanted to write the introduction for the Batman Universe collection, and why I so genuinely loved that book was, it was a reminder to me — just as a fan and a reader in a kind of era of Batman where everything was just, like, so huge, and earth-shatteringly big, and heavy and dark and operatic — that the character can also love dinosaurs, you know?” Fraction said. “Brian's book was just such a contrast to where the median Batman, the average, was at that moment. But they're both still Batman.”

Fraction continued, saying that he loved Brian Michael Bendis’s version of the character because “he’s capable of wonder and joy, and it's not all little, tiny victories, like, ‘Well, the hospital burned down, but I saved this one kid,' or whatever. I want a character that, like, knows it's awesome to be Batman! That was important to me. He's a person who's capable of joy and feeling wonder and love, and understands what a kind of privileged perspective he has being Batman in the DC Universe.”

Batman: Universe Deluxe Edition will be released February 10, 2026. The first issue of Matt Fraction’s Batman series with Jorge Jiménez is available now.
